BIM Q&A | Is There an Easy Way to Connect Squat Toilets, Seated Toilets, and Pipes in Revit?
When connecting squat toilets, seated toilets, and pipes in Revit, you typically need to draw a water trap manually, which can be quite complicated and time-consuming. Is there a faster method to streamline this process?
Indeed, creating a water trap can be quite a hassle! Revit’s native tools require step-by-step connections, which can slow down your workflow. However, there are plugins available that simplify this task.
For example, the Modeling Master plugin offers a device connection feature that automatically generates the required trap. This tool is very efficient and can save a lot of time.
In addition to toilets, this plugin also supports automatic connections for other devices like air conditioning units and fire hydrants, making it a versatile solution for various plumbing and mechanical connections.
